Our Board

Humphrey Howie

Presiding Member

Humphrey is the proprietor of an organic citrus-growing and packing enterprise, and has a degree in Agricultural Science and a Diploma in Permaculture Design.

Humphrey’s family business has been growing fruit on the same land for over 100 years. The orchard began converting to organic management in 1994 and is certified organic with the National Association for Sustainable Agriculture Australia.

Humphrey has worked in salinity and water management in South Australia and been involved with a range of natural resource management organisations. Humphrey is currently a member of the Bookmark Creek Action Group and Chair of the Renmark Environmental Watering Committee.

Humphrey has been on the Trust Board since 1997 and was elected Presiding Member in 2019.


Kate Strachan

Deputy Presiding Member

Kate is a viticulturist with over 27 years of experience in the winegrape growing industry, beginning with Southcorp in the Barossa Valley and the Riverland, and then at Taylors Wines and Knappstein Wines in the Clare Valley. In 2013, she returned to the family fruit property in Renmark to grow figs, pomegranates and winegrapes and is a fifth-generation grower. Kate has a degree in Agricultural Science and a Graduate Diploma in Education.

Kate has expertise in the technical aspects of viticulture, horticulture, logistics, procurement and project management. Kate is also an agricultural educator, believing that education at all levels is the key to the long term social, economic and environmental sustainability of our agricultural sector.

Kate was elected to the Trust Board in 2013, and was elected Deputy Presiding Member in 2019.


David Ludas

Assistant Deputy Presiding Member

David’s involvement with the Wine Industry spans over 40 years serving on a range of industry bodies. David, together with his wife and son, manages 50 hectares of vineyard in Renmark North.

David has seen and experienced major changes in irrigation infrastructure, management, and water policy. David is passionate and committed to representing Trust members and the district to ensure their water entitlements are being supplied.

David sits on the South Australian Murray Irrigators' Committee and was a member of South Australia's River Murray Advisory Committee.

David was elected to the Trust Board in 2007, and was elected Assistant Deputy Presiding Member in 2019.


James Butler

Director

James is a grower with irrigation properties within the Renmark and Chaffey districts.

James has been a Director of the Renmark Irrigation Trust since 2012 and also currently sits on the South Australian Murray Irrigators (SAMI) Committee and the Bookmark Creek Action Group.


Ibrahim Demir

Director

Ibrahim’s family migrated to Australia from Turkey in 1970, settling in Sydney before moving to Renmark in 1977.

Ibrahim has been involved in fruit growing in Renmark since 1980, being involved in all aspects of the operation and production of produce.

Ibrahim was elected to the Trust Board in 2004.


Jasvindar Kor

Director

Jasvindar co-manages Bachra Produce which operates an irrigated horticulture and packing shed business. Stone fruit is grown for sale on the Australian fresh market, together with wine grapes and oranges.

Jasvindar grew up in Fiji and has been in Renmark since 2000.

Jasvindar was appointed to the Trust Board in 2021.


Jim Markeas

Director

Jim manages the family owned Mallee Estate winery in Renmark, which produces all wines onsite and offers a cellar door and restaurant experience. The winery uses estate grown grapes with the first vineyard established by his immigrant parents in 1969.

Mallee Estate Wines was established in 1998 and has experienced global and domestic success, being awarded Riverland winery of the year at the New York International wine competition from 2015-2019. Jim’s vision is to continue to drive the family business forward and expand by value adding to its core foundation of irrigated primary production. 

Jim holds a Bachelor of Applied Science (Wine Science) and in 2015 was awarded Riverland Winemaker of the Year. Jim is also a director at Riverland Wine (as a winemaker representative) and is active in the local community.

Jim was elected to the Trust Board in 2016.
